Overview

Azure Local node. The Dell AX-6515 is a single-socket 1U node built on AMD EPYC. For Azure Local it is the licence-efficient compute option โ€” one modern EPYC part gives a full node's worth of cores without a second socket, which keeps both rack density and per-core licensing in check.

Where it fits

Edge and branch clusters, and consolidation where a single EPYC socket covers the vCPU budget. Step up to the dual-socket AX-7525 when a site needs more compute or an all-NVMe storage tier.
